%% @private %% @copyright 2023 Erlang Solutions Ltd. -module(amoc_users_sup). -behaviour(supervisor). -export([start_link/0, stop_child/2, stop_children/2]). -export([init/1]). -define(SERVER, ?MODULE). -define(SHUTDOWN_TIMEOUT, 2000). %% 2 seconds -spec start_link() -> {ok, Pid :: pid()}. start_link() -> supervisor:start_link({local, ?SERVER}, ?MODULE, []). -spec stop_child(pid(), boolean()) -> ok | {error, any()}. stop_child(Pid, true) -> Node = node(Pid), supervisor:terminate_child({amoc_users_sup, Node}, Pid); stop_child(Pid, false) when is_pid(Pid) -> exit(Pid, shutdown), %% do it in the same way as supervisor!!! ok. %% @doc Stop users, possibly in parallel %% %% Stopping users one by one using supervisor:terminate_child/2 is %% not an option because terminate_child requests are queued and %% processed by the supervisor sequentially, and if the user process ignores %% the `exit(Child, shutdown)' signal, that causes a `?SHUTDOWN_TIMEOUT' delay %% before it's killed by `exit(Child, kill)'. So an attempt to remove N %% users may take take `N * ?SHUTDOWN_TIMEOUT' milliseconds, which is %% not acceptable. So let's do the same thing as the supervisor but in %% parallel, so it won't result in a huge delay. -spec stop_children([pid()], boolean()) -> ok. stop_children(Pids, false) -> [stop_child(Pid, false) || Pid <- Pids], ok; stop_children(Pids, true) -> spawn( fun() -> [exit(Pid, shutdown) || Pid <- Pids], timer:sleep(?SHUTDOWN_TIMEOUT), [exit(Pid, kill) || Pid <- Pids] end), ok. -spec init(term()) -> {ok, {supervisor:sup_flags(), [supervisor:child_spec()]}}. init([]) -> process_flag(priority, high), SupFlags = #{strategy => simple_one_for_one}, AChild = #{id => amoc_user, start => {amoc_user, start_link, []}, %% A temporary child process is never restarted restart => temporary, %% sending exit(Child,shutdown) first. If a process doesn't stop within %% the shutdown timeout, than killing it brutally with exit(Child,kill). shutdown => ?SHUTDOWN_TIMEOUT, type => worker, modules => [amoc_user]}, {ok, {SupFlags, [AChild]}}.
